> A friend is looking for someone to be a "jack of all trades" in an
> office in the Morrisville-RTP area of the Triangle.
>
> The short version is:
>
> *Summary:* Experienced, versatile office manager/bookkeeper to handle all 
> employee-related matters including payroll, insurance administration and 
> reporting requirements; financial/accounting data entry and general 
> bookkeeping using QuickBooks online (including payroll, payables and 
> receivables management), and the general administrative duties required 
> to support US operation and interface with office in India.  Must be well 
> organized, able to set priorities and have an acute attention to detail. 
> Good communications skills (written and oral).  We seek responsive and 
> customer-service oriented candidate who will bring positive energy to the 
> organization.  Sense of Urgency and handling handful of tasks every day 
> whose priorities are all numbered 1 is an essential criteria for a 
> successful candidate.
